"Miss Rebecca Wimer
Miss Rebecca Wimer, 89 years old, died last night at a local hospital following a recent fall and a broken hip. During infancy Miss Wimer lost her sense of hearing and she never learned to speak. The family developed a sign language by means of which they communicated. Since the death of her sister, Harriet, about a year ago, no one has been able to converse with her. Being aged and frail her welfare had been a problem to her friends. She had no near relatives, but Miss Vida Graham has seen to her comfort, and during most of the period Mrs. Carrie Conzett nursed her.
Miss Wimer was a member of Second Presbyterian church, faithfully attending worship services with her sister, on whom she had always been dependent, until the latter's death.
Funeral services will be held Friday at 1:30 at the Walker mortuary. Rev. Anthony P. Landgraf will conduct the services and interment will be made in City cemetery." On 26 April 1944 at
